Black/African Science Fiction begins from a recognition that colonialism, enslavement, racial capitalism, and law remain deeply entangled. Yet rather than accepting the futures these systems predict, Afrofuturism and Africanfuturism ask us to imagine otherwise. I explore the convergences and tensions between these genres and argue that they do far more than imagine alternative futures. They challenge the colonial ordering of time, expose the limits of Euro-modern law, and create space to reimagine justice beyond racialised histories of violence. https://folukeafrica.com/afrofuturism-and-africanfuturism-duelling-and-dwelling-within-black-african-science-fiction/
